Sun Java System Portal Server Secure Remote Access 7.2 管理指南

关于“用户会话 Cookie 转发到的 URL”属性

portal server 利用 cookie 跟踪用户会话。当网关向服务器提出 HTTP 请求时(例如,当调用桌面 servlet 以生成用户桌面页时),此 cookie 将被转发到服务器。服务器上的应用程序使用该 cookie 来确认并标识用户。

Portal Server 的 cookie 不会被转发到向该服务器以外的其他机器发出的 HTTP 请求,除非在“用户会话 Cookie 转发到的 URL”列表中指定了那些机器上的 URL。因此向此列表中添加 URL 可使 servlet 和 CGI 接收 Portal Server 的 cookie,并使用 API 来标识用户。

URL 使用隐含的后缀通配符进行匹配。例如,列表的默认条目:

http://server:8080

会使 cookie 被转发到所有以 http://server:8080 开始的 URL。

添加:

http://newmachine.eng.siroe.com/subdir

会使 cookie 被转发到所有开头与该字符串完全相同的 URL。

在此例中,cookie 不会转发到任何以“http://newmachine.eng/subdir”开始的 URL,因为该字符串的开头部分与转发列表中的字符串不完全相同。要将 cookie 转发到以这个改变的机器名开始的 URL,必须向转发列表添加新的条目。

同样,cookie 也不会转发到以“https://newmachine.eng.siroe.com/subdir”开始的 URL,除非向列表中添加相应的条目。